Resolution Together One Lawyer for Both of You

Resolution Together allows a separating couple to use the same solicitor to advise them, so they do not need individual solicitors. It is suitable for separating couples whose joint aim is to reach an outcome that meets both of their needs, and if they are parents, the needs of their children. They must be on the same page and willing to work together amicably.

How Resolution Together Works

Our Resolution Together solicitor, Genette Gale, would initially see the separating couple together for a short appointment to explain how Resolution Together works.

If they both wish to use Resolution Together, they then would each need to see Genette, for separate individual appointments on different days.

The purpose of the individual appointments is to make sure that Resolution Together is right for them.

After the individual appointments, a date will be booked for the first joint appointment so the separating couple can discuss the legal issues with Genette, for example division of the finances due to the separation, and/or the arrangements for the children.

While it is for the separating couple to decide what is right for them, Genette will be there to give you both information on the legal process which applies and what a court may think or consider, with the aim of trying to help the separating couple reach an agreement. If they both reach an agreement, Genette can incorporate it into a written agreement or court order whichever is appropriate.

Cost Benefits

Resolution Together, can be more cost effective than formal court proceedings, if you both reach an agreement through Resolution Together.

Requirements for Resolution Together

If you wish to engage in Resolution Together you both must be willing to be open and honest about your financial situation to one another, and to cooperate with providing information, to enable you both to have the information you both need, to make a decision.

Who is Resolution Together For

Resolution Together is for people who are amicable and willing to work together. You can also find out more about Resolution Together on Resolution’s website
